(5R-cis)-Toluene-4-sulfonic Acid 5-(2,4-Difluorophenyl)-5-[1,2,4]triazol-1-ylmethyltetrahydrofuran-3-ylmethyl Ester, a chemical with a complex structure, is a synthetic intermediate frequently used in the creation of pharmaceutical compounds. The molecule features a toluene-sulfonic acid ester linked to a difluorophenyl group and a triazolylmethyltetrahydrofuran moiety, showcasing a sophisticated architecture that plays a crucial role in its activity and utility in synthetic chemistry. In research settings, this compound′s specific mechanisms involve acting as a precursor in the synthesis of more complex molecules, particularly those involving triazole rings, which are valuable in various biochemical applications due to their robustness and versatility. The triazole component, known for its ability to bind with a variety of enzymes and receptors due to its unique electron distribution and hydrogen bonding capabilities, makes this compound a key subject in studies focused on developing new synthetic pathways and methodologies. Additionally, its incorporation into larger, more complex molecules has been explored extensively in materials science and catalysis, aiming to leverage its structural properties to enhance stability and reactivity in novel synthetic materials. This research is pivotal in advancing the understanding of molecular interactions and transformations, contributing to innovations in synthetic organic chemistry.
